Uncover the hidden costs of our AI-driven world. In "The Cognitive Effects of Artificial Intelligence Over-Reliance on Human Physiology and Mental Health," Dakota Frandsen delivers a critical analysis of how our increasing dependence on AI is reshaping the human mind. Drawing on cutting-edge neuroscience and behavioral studies, this essential read reveals the alarming impact on attention, memory, and critical thinking, and explores the physiological and psychological toll of digital over-reliance. More than just a warning, this book offers evidence-based strategies-from cognitive training to digital detoxes-to reclaim cognitive autonomy and foster a truly beneficial human-AI collaboration. Discover how to thrive in an AI-saturated future, safeguarding your mind while harnessing technology's power.
